About this video

During this guided reading session, the students will be working on an instructional level C book.

Using Fountas and Pinnell's Literacy Continuum, they state the features of a level B text consists of two lines of print, patterned language, and supportive illustrations. Now, in my guided reading lesson, I wanted to support the students in the 'new' type of book they'll be reading (level C) by providing a little bit of a text level introduction along with supporting them with the oral language that's in the text. I felt this was important since they've been in level B for a few months now and they are used to patterned language on every page.

We have been working on characters and character traits during interactive read aloud so it's always great to bring in that work during guided reading so students continuously think about, "how the character is feeling...and why? What kind of person/character is he/she?"
